fre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

微型計(jì)算機(jī)控制技術(shù)課程設(shè)計(jì)---步進(jìn)電機(jī)角度控制(已修改)

2025-01-24 04:52 本頁(yè)面
 

【正文】 1 課 程 設(shè) 計(jì) 課程名稱(chēng) 微型計(jì)算機(jī)控制技術(shù) 題目名稱(chēng) __步進(jìn)電機(jī)角度控制 (2) 學(xué)生學(xué)院 ____ _ 自動(dòng)化 ________ 專(zhuān)業(yè)班級(jí) ____ 學(xué) 號(hào) 學(xué)生姓名 ___ _ 指導(dǎo)教師 ______ 李傳芳 _____ 2022 年 06 月 28 日 2 一、軟件設(shè)計(jì)流程圖如下圖所示 : 二、心得與體會(huì) 這次的課程設(shè)計(jì)主要針對(duì) 鍵盤(pán)及可編程接口芯片 8255A 的編程,在上機(jī)調(diào)試過(guò)程中由于自己的疏忽及算法的不完善導(dǎo)致了程序不能實(shí)現(xiàn)預(yù)期的功能,經(jīng)過(guò)一遍又一遍的檢查和思考,終于完成了這次課程設(shè)計(jì)的任務(wù)。 雖然上機(jī)調(diào)試的經(jīng)歷是痛苦的,但是期間的細(xì)節(jié)錯(cuò)誤給了我們應(yīng)有的教訓(xùn),使我們?cè)谝院蟮膶W(xué)習(xí)及工作中盡量避免,對(duì)于匯編語(yǔ)言的編程也有了進(jìn)一步的了解 加深了對(duì) 步進(jìn)電機(jī) 的理解和使用技巧, 設(shè)計(jì) 中,需要對(duì)步進(jìn)電機(jī)進(jìn)行角度控制, 即 需要對(duì)步進(jìn)電機(jī)的 角度 進(jìn)行計(jì)算分析,以得到所需 的 步數(shù) 。 總之,這次課程設(shè)計(jì)鍛煉了我解決問(wèn)題的能力,激發(fā)了我的思考,相信通過(guò)這次課程設(shè)計(jì)對(duì)我以后對(duì)微機(jī)的繼續(xù)學(xué)習(xí)及以后的工作會(huì)有很大的幫助。 開(kāi)始 設(shè)定 8255A 工作方式, A、B 口輸出, C 口 PC4~PC7 輸入, PC0~PC3 輸出 ,故 控制字為 88H 掃描鍵盤(pán) 是否有鍵按 下 判斷鍵值 否 是 延時(shí) LED 顯示 驅(qū)動(dòng)電機(jī)動(dòng)作 延時(shí) 返回調(diào)用 判斷鍵值 3 任務(wù) 1 連接數(shù)碼管顯示電路和鍵盤(pán)電路,實(shí)現(xiàn)如下表所示的按鍵控制,并能夠左移顯示: 3 6 0 A B 7 2 F : STACK SEGMENT STACK DB 64 DUP(?) STACK ENDS DATA SEGMENT ORG 0030H VAR1 DB 0FCH,0FCH,0FCH,0FCH VAR5 DB OF7H,0FBH,0FDH,0FEH VAR2 DB 0FCH,0FCH,0FCH,0FCH,0FCH,0FCH,0FCH,0FCH VAR3 DB 00H,00H,00H,00H,00H,00H,00H,00H VAR4 DB 00H,00H,00H,00H,00H,00H,00H,00H TABLE1 DB 0FCH,60H,0DAH,0F2H,66H,0B6H,0BEH,0E0H,0FEH,0F6H,0EEH,3EH,9CH,7AH,9EH,8EH DATA ENDS CODE SEGMENT ASSUME CS:CODE,DS:DATA START: MOV AX,DATA MOV DS,AX MOV AL,88H 。8255初始化 MOV DX,0606H OUT DX,AL STT: MOV AL,60H MOV DX,0604H OUT DX,AL NEXT: MOV DX,0604H IN AL, DX AND AL,60H CMP AL,60H JNZ KEYABC CALL DISP JMP STT 。.............鍵盤(pán)掃描 ................................................. KEYABC:CALL TIME MOV DX,0604H IN AL,DX AND AL,60H CMP AL,60H 。PC6 PC5 =0110 0000 JNZ KEY JMP STT KEY: MOV AL,0FEH 。掃描 PC0口 PC0=0 MOV DX,0604H OUT DX,AL MOV DX,0604H IN AL,DX TEST AL,20H 。檢測(cè) PC5 JNZ KEY_F CALL KEYA JMP STTK KEY_F: TEST AL,040H 。檢測(cè) PC6口 JNZ KEY_0 CALL KEYF JMP STTK KEY_0:MOV AL,0FDH 。掃描 PC1口 , PC1=0 MOV DX,0604H OUT DX,AL MOV DX,0604H IN AL,DX TEST AL,20H 。檢測(cè) PC5 JNZ KEY_2 CALL KEY0 JMP STTK KEY_2:TEST AL,040H 。檢測(cè) PC6口 JNZ KEY_6 CALL KEYF ;否則是按鍵 2 JMP STTK KEY_6:MOV AL,0FBH 。PC2=0 MOV DX,0604H 4 OUT DX,AL MOV DX,0604H IN AL,DX TEST AL,20H 。檢測(cè) PC5 JNZ KEY_7 CALL KEY6 JMP STTK KEY_7:TEST AL,040H 。檢測(cè) PC6口 JNZ KEY_3 CALL KEY7 JMP STTK KEY_3:MOV AL,0F7H PC3=0 MOV DX,0604H OUT DX,AL MOV DX,0604H IN AL,DX TEST AL,20H 。檢測(cè) PC5 JNZ KEY_B CALL KEY3
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評(píng)公示相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
公安備案圖鄂ICP備17016276號(hào)-1